"The 2019 Vosne-Romanée 1er Cru Les Malconsorts has turned out brilliantly. Mingling aromas of blackberries and cassis with hints of orange rind, rose petals, licorice, sweet spices and loamy soil, it's full-bodied, ample and multidimensional, with a deep and concentrated core of fruit that largely conceals its fine structuring tannins. Concluding with a long, sapid finish, it will require a bit of patience, but in 2019, it isn't as brooding as young Malconsorts can often be. Domaine de Montille's cellars are cold, and élevage is unhurried. These are often among the harder wines to read during my fall barrel tastings. So, this year, I asked winemaker Brian Sieve to instead present some finished 2019s in bottle. The vintage has turned out beautifully, delivering moderate alcohols (up to 13.5%) and terrific concentration in both colors. Fine-boned and elegant, the whites are tightly wound and built to age, and the reds are supple, charming and perfumed. (WK) "
